IELTS vs PTE vs TOEFL: Which English Test Is Best for Study Abroad in 2026?

 IELTS vs PTE vs TOEFL: Which English Test Is Best for Study Abroad in 2026?


As international education evolves in 2026, choosing the right English proficiency test has become a strategic decision rather than a mere formality. While all three major tests—IELTS, PTE, and TOEFL—are widely accepted, they differ significantly in their delivery format, scoring patterns, and geographic preferences. Understanding these nuances is essential for students to align their natural test-taking strengths with the requirements of their target destination.

IELTS (International English Language Testing System)

IELTS remains the most recognized English test globally, particularly in the UK, Australia, Canada, and New Zealand. In 2026, it continues to offer both Paper-Based and Computer-Delivered formats, providing flexibility for students who prefer handwriting over typing.

  • Key Characteristics: The standout feature of IELTS is the Speaking module, which is conducted as a face-to-face interview with a human examiner. This is ideal for students who find talking to a computer awkward or robotic.

  • Scoring: Results are reported on a band scale of 1 to 9. Most universities require an overall band of 6.5 or 7.0.

  • Best Suited For: Students targeting the UK or Australia, and those who prefer a traditional conversational format for the speaking assessment.

PTE Academic (Pearson Test of English)

PTE has seen a massive surge in popularity in 2026 due to its entirely computer-based nature and rapid results. It is the preferred choice for students who are tech-savvy and want their scores processed within 24 to 48 hours.

  • Key Characteristics: Every module, including Speaking, is assessed by AI. The test is integrated, meaning one task can contribute to scores in multiple sections (e.g., "Read Aloud" tests both Reading and Speaking). This allows for a more holistic assessment of language skills.

  • Scoring: Scores are provided on a scale of 10 to 90. The AI scoring is highly objective, eliminating human bias, though it requires clear pronunciation and consistent pacing.

  • Best Suited For: Students applying to Australian and New Zealand universities, or those who need fast results to meet tight application deadlines.

TOEFL iBT (Test of English as a Foreign Language)

TOEFL is the gold standard for students targeting the United States. In 2026, the test remains highly academic in nature, focusing on how well a student can communicate in a university classroom setting.

  • Key Characteristics: The test is almost entirely academic. The Speaking section involves listening to a lecture or reading a passage and then responding to a computer. It requires strong note-taking skills and the ability to synthesize information quickly.

  • Scoring: The test is scored out of 120 points, with 30 points allocated to each of the four sections.

  • Best Suited For: Students aiming for Ivy League schools or top-tier American universities, as well as those who are comfortable with high-level academic vocabulary and synthesized tasks.

Factors to Consider When Choosing Your Test

When deciding which test to take in 2026, you should consider three primary factors: university acceptance, your typing speed, and your comfort with technology. While the US predominantly favors TOEFL, many American institutions now accept IELTS and PTE. Conversely, the UK and Australia have a strong preference for IELTS and PTE.

Furthermore, if you struggle with handwriting, the computer-based PTE or TOEFL might be better. If you find AI-based speaking assessments stressful, the human-led IELTS interview is the safer path. Most students in 2026 take a diagnostic mock test for all three formats to see which scoring algorithm favors their specific communication style.
